When/where/how was your comapany established?
In 1971, The Australian surfer and shaper Terry Fitzgerald created Hotbuttered surfboards. HB built a reputation worldwide based on quality, design productions and innovations introduced by TF and colored by Martin Worthington's airbrush. From the 80's, HB evolved it's surfing philosophy into other products including clothing during the 90's, and then sunglasses. Hot buttered international now distributes to 22 countries world-wide.
Terry Fitzgerald and HB have never lost sight of their roots- the thrill of riding waves and producing the best product possible for surfing.
